Welcome Brian!

Your Patrol is a very complete early soft top, with the uber rare tailgate and side-mounted spare (most US market Patrols had a swing-away rear spare mount and side-hinge rear doors.

Does your Patrol still have the ID tag on the firewall behind the valve cover? If so, then please check out this thread, and snap some pictures of the numbers on the frame, engine, and the ID tag:

Hey guys...thanks for the welcomes! I only know where the vehicle has been since 1981. A lady in small town purchased in 1981 from a dealer in the same town (Crisfield Maryland). I assume she drove it for a short period of time with so few miles on it. Most of its life was parked inside a chicken house for 20-30 years. It was purchased by a flea market dealer. I think he had it for about the past 2-3 years. His brother owned a used car dealership where I found it. After a few phone calls, it was on a tow truck back to my house.

Unfortunately the ID plate is missing. The title has L60200680 as the VIN. I assume those numbers would match. Isnt there supposed to be stamping on the frame somewhere?

I am very novice the the patrols. After just your guys comments I am VERY excited. I was thinking someone relocated the spare tire carrier during its life and started dreading searching for the correct parts. I am glad I was wrong!

Learning about the rarity of the vehicle, I think it would be a smart plan to keep and restore it. Any advice and/or suggestions are welcome!
